Barnaul Weather in July

With daytime temperatures of 27°C (81°F) and nighttime lows of 15°C (59°F), July in Barnaul brings high temperatures during the day. It is also the wettest month of the year, so pack an umbrella.

Rainfall in Barnaul in July

Given that this is the rainiest month, it's wise to carry an umbrella to stay dry during unexpected showers. Expect around 12 days of rain based on historical data, with 79 mm (3.1 in) average. A fairly balanced picture this month, some wet days but nothing too extreme in terms of intensity.

Barnaul historical weather extremes in July

The extremes listed below come from historical weather data collected in Barnaul from 1976 through 2025.

  • The warmest day in July was on July 12, 2014, with a maximum of 37°C (99°F).
  • The lowest overnight temperature recorded in July was 5°C (41°F) (July 2, 2009).
